Subject: [Intel-gfx] [PATCH 7/8] drm/i915/fbc: Implement Wa_16011863758 for icl+

There's some kind of weird corner cases in FBC which requires
FBC segments to be separated by at least one extra cacheline.
Make sure that is present.

TODO: the formula laid out in the spec seem to be semi-nonsense
so this is mostly my interpretation on what it is actually trying
to say. Need to wait for clarification from the hw folks to know
for sure.

+	/*
+	 * Wa_16011863758: icl+
+	 * CFB segment stride needs at least one extra cacheline.
+	 * We make sure each line has an extra cacheline so that
+	 * the 4 line segment will have one regarless of the
+	 * compression limit we choose later.
+	 */
+	if (DISPLAY_VER(i915) >= 11)
+		stride = max(stride, cache->plane.src_w * 4 + 64u);
